Toasted Crackers Rosemary & Olive Oil is the more energy-dense option here, packing 133 more calories per 100g than Wiley wallaby licorice allsorts. If you are looking for sustained energy or fueling a workout, this higher caloric density might be an advantage.
In terms of sugar control, Toasted Crackers Rosemary & Olive Oil takes the lead with only 6.25g of sugar per 100g, whereas Wiley wallaby licorice allsorts contains 56.7g. Lower sugar content is often linked to better metabolic health.
Looking to build muscle? Toasted Crackers Rosemary & Olive Oil offers a protein boost with 6.25g per 100g, outperforming Wiley wallaby licorice allsorts in this category.
